Technical Specs and Performance Attributes of the K20
The K20 engine, known for its compact yet powerful layout, sticks out worldwide of auto design due to its remarkable technical requirements and performance functions. Its i-VTEC (Intelligent Variable Shutoff Timing and Raise Digital Control) system boosts effectiveness, while assisting in a wide power band. The engine, basically a 2.0-liter four-cylinder, produces between 155 to 212 horsepower, depending upon the version. The K20's high compression proportion (roughly 11:1) adds to its impressive performance. Its light-weight construction, mostly using aluminium, enhances gas performance. In addition, the engine's low-emission technology aligns with modern green criteria. Significantly, its integrity and sturdiness are acclaimed, with several K20 engines surpassing 200,000 miles without substantial problems. Acura RSX Type-S
An additional notable instance of a lorry showcasing the K20 engine's excellent capacities is the Acura RSX Type-S. This sporting activities coupe, produced in between 2002 and 2006, housed an i-VTEC K20A2 or K20Z1 engine, relying on the production year. This durable engine, coupled with the automobile's lightweight body, made the RSX Type-S a force to be considered. The engine's 200 horsepower at 7,400 RPM and 142 lb-ft of torque at 6,000 RPM gave this lorry a speedy response and a zippy acceleration. Its impressive power-to-weight ratio better enhanced its performance. With a 6-speed guidebook transmission, the RSX Type-S supplied smooth shifting and optimum control, embodying the K20 engine's potential in a small yet powerful plan.
